摘要

The current ASME code considers the effective gasket width to be constant for particular gasket geometry. This study has clearly demonstrated that this is not true for sheet gasket material. It was found that the effective width depends on the applied load, the rotational flexibility of the flange and the type of gasket. For sheet gaskets, the maximum gasket stress located at the gasket outer periphery and hence the thickness of the gasket at this location is found to be one of the key parameter that controls leakage. Flange rotation is found to be beneficial for CF and FG sheet gaskets but not for double jacketed metal gaskets.
